MCP + Azure Functions = MCP Serverless
AI agents want tools, and developers want a simple way to deliver them without managing infrastructure. This session shows how Azure Functions can be used to build a remote MCP server and expose capabilities through the MCP Tool trigger, giving teams a serverless way to make business logic available to MCP clients and agentic applications. Using C# (and not only) and Azure Functions, the session walks through how a function becomes a tool, how discovery and invocation work, and where this approach fits in real-world architectures.
The focus is practical: architecture, code, demos, and design choices that matter when moving from experimentation to production. Attendees will leave with a clear understanding of when Azure Functions is a good fit for MCP workloads, how to structure tools for reuse and scale, which implementation details deserve attention early, and which pitfalls to avoid when exposing serverless functions to AI-driven workflows. The session is aimed at developers and architects who want a concrete, modern pattern for building MCP-enabled solutions on Azure.
